河北实业有限公司

半导体集成电路 ·
首页 / 资讯 / FPGA数字电路设计入门:从基础到实践

FPGA数字电路设计入门:从基础到实践

FPGA数字电路设计入门:从基础到实践
半导体集成电路 fpga数字电路设计入门 发布:2026-06-16

标题:FPGA数字电路设计入门:从基础到实践

一、FPGA概述

FPGA(Field-Programmable Gate Array,现场可编程门阵列)是一种可编程逻辑器件,它允许用户在芯片上实现数字电路设计。与传统的ASIC(Application-Specific Integrated Circuit,专用集成电路)相比,FPGA具有灵活性、可重用性和快速迭代的特点,因此在数字电路设计领域得到了广泛应用。

二、FPGA设计流程

1. 设计输入:使用EDA(Electronic Design Automation,电子设计自动化)工具进行电路设计,将设计转换为硬件描述语言(HDL)代码。

2. 仿真验证:通过仿真工具对设计进行功能验证,确保设计满足预期要求。

3. 生成比特流:将仿真验证后的设计转换为比特流文件。

4. 布局布线:将比特流文件映射到FPGA芯片的物理结构上,进行布局布线。

5. 烧录编程:将生成的比特流文件烧录到FPGA芯片中,完成编程。

三、FPGA数字电路设计要点

1. 选择合适的FPGA器件:根据设计需求,选择具有合适逻辑资源、时序性能和功耗的FPGA器件。

2. 设计优化:合理分配资源,提高设计效率;优化时序,降低功耗。

3. 仿真验证:充分验证设计功能,确保设计满足性能要求。

4. 代码编写规范:遵循HDL编程规范,提高代码可读性和可维护性。

四、FPGA数字电路设计工具

1. HDL编程语言:VHDL、Verilog等。

2. EDA工具:Vivado、Quartus等。

3. 仿真工具:ModelSim、Vivado Simulator等。

五、FPGA数字电路设计应用

FPGA在数字电路设计领域具有广泛的应用,如:

1. 通信领域:高速数据传输、信号处理、协议转换等。

2. 消费电子:音视频处理、图像处理、智能家居等。

3. 工业控制:电机控制、传感器数据处理、工业自动化等。

总结:

FPGA数字电路设计入门需要掌握FPGA器件特性、设计流程、设计要点以及相关工具。通过不断学习和实践,可以逐步提高FPGA数字电路设计能力。在应用FPGA进行数字电路设计时,要关注行业动态,紧跟技术发展趋势,以适应不断变化的市场需求。

本文由 河北实业有限公司 整理发布。

更多半导体集成电路文章

新能源汽车半导体国产替代品牌:趋势与挑战并存**FPGA仿真软件Vivado:入门必备技能与操作指南晶圆代工工艺节点:如何选择最适合的路径**半导体材料分类解析:揭秘型号背后的奥秘光刻胶:揭秘半导体制造中的隐形英雄氮化镓功率放大器:揭秘其批发价格背后的技术奥秘国产芯片设计:探秘其背后的技术与挑战广州MCU编程语言培训:入门与进阶指南半导体设备出厂检测标准制定:确保品质与安全的关键**MEMS晶圆代工:揭秘晶圆制造的关键步骤晶圆尺寸与台积电代工价格:揭秘背后的逻辑光伏逆变器功率器件安装:关键步骤与注意事项
友情链接: 佛山市科技有限公司浙江科技有限公司无锡市袜业有限公司广州信息科技有限公司杭州科技有限公司大连贸易有限公司企业管理咨询(上海)有限公司旅游酒店任丘市金属制品有限公司建筑施工